1. Mechanical Excellence: Working Principles and High-Performance Materials

The operational principle of the Fan Drive Gearbox is rooted in the physics of rotational dynamics. It serves as a speed increaser where a large diameter input gear drives a smaller diameter output pinion. At Agrinuclear Nucleo Agro, we utilize a specialized helical gear configuration which offers superior contact ratios compared to standard spur gears. This design ensures a smoother transition of power, significantly reducing the vibration levels that can often lead to premature fan blade fatigue. The interior of our gearboxes is a masterpiece of lubrication engineering; we employ splash lubrication systems with integrated cooling fins on the exterior housing to ensure that the synthetic gear oil maintains its viscosity even during the peak heat of a Brazilian summer. The input shaft is typically designed to match the standard 1-3/8 inch 6-spline PTO found on most Massey Ferguson, John Deere, and Valtra tractors commonly used across Brazil, while the output shaft is precision-machined to accommodate various fan hub diameters with keyed or splined interfaces.

Materials selection is where Agrinuclear Nucleo Agro sets itself apart from domestic competitors. The main housing is cast from high-grade nodular cast iron (GGG40 or GGG50), providing excellent dampening properties and structural rigidity. The gears themselves are forged from 20CrMnTi or 8620 alloy steel, which undergoes a rigorous process of carburizing and quenching to reach a surface hardness of 58-62 HRC. This creates a “hard-on-the-outside, tough-on-the-inside” profile that can handle the sudden shock loads associated with engaging the PTO at varying engine speeds. Seals are sourced from premium fluoroelastomer (Viton) materials to resist the corrosive nature of agricultural chemicals and the high temperatures generated near the fan assembly. Spécification Technique Industrial Standard / Performance Data
Plage de rapports de démultiplication 1:3.0 to 1:4.5 (Customizable for Axial/Centrifugal Fans)
Input Power Rating 30 HP – 120 HP (Continuous Duty)
Matériaux de construction Nodular Cast Iron GGG50 (High Thermal Conductivity)
Gear Hardness HRC 58-62 (Carburized and Case-Hardened)
Lubrication Type ISO VG 150/220 Synthetic Gear Oil (High Load Additives)
Input/Output Interface Standard 6-Spline (PTO) / Keyed Shaft (Fan Side)

3. Global and Brazilian Regulatory Compliance for Agricultural Machinery

Navigating the legal landscape of agricultural machinery in Brazil requires a deep understanding of NR-12 (Norma Regulamentadora 12). This stringent regulation governs the safety of machinery and equipment, emphasizing the protection of operators from rotating parts. Our gearboxes are designed with integrated mounting points for safety shields and guards that comply with NR-12 requirements, ensuring that Brazilian farmers can pass labor inspections without additional modifications. Furthermore, Agrinuclear Nucleo Agro adheres to ABNT (Associação Brasileira de Normas Técnicas) standards, particularly those relating to agricultural power transmission components. We ensure that our noise emission levels are within the limits prescribed for agricultural work environments, reducing long-term auditory risks for tractor operators. In Brazil, compliance is not just about safety; it is also about environmental stewardship, as defined by the Ministry of Agriculture, Livestock, and Supply (MAPA), which mandates precision in chemical application to prevent soil contamination.

On a global scale, our gearboxes meet or exceed the requirements of the European CE marking and ISO 9001:2015 quality management systems. In North America, we align with ASAE (American Society of Agricultural Engineers) standards for PTO drivelines and safety. Q4. Why should a farm manager choose a helical fan drive gearbox over a traditional spur gear design for their orchard mist blower?

A4. Helical gears offer a higher contact ratio and smoother engagement, which significantly reduces mechanical noise and vibration, leading to a longer lifespan for the fan bearings and a more comfortable operating environment for the tractor driver.
